What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Freelance Junior Java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Freelance Junior Java Developer, you need a solid grasp of Java programming, basic software development principles, and a relevant degree or coursework in computer science. Familiarity with tools like Eclipse or IntelliJ IDEA, version control systems such as Git, and an understanding of basic frameworks like Spring Boot are typ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ective time management, and clear communication make you stand out when collaborating remotely with clients. These skills and qualities are essential to deliver reliable code, meet project deadlines, and build lasting professional relationships as a freelancer.

What are some common challenges freelance junior Java developers face when starting out, and how can they overcome them?

Freelance junior Java developers often face challenges such as finding consistent projects, adapting quickly to different client codebases, and managing their own schedules and client communications. Building a strong online portfolio and actively networking in developer communities can help attract more clients. Additionally, setting clear expectations with clients and continuously improving technical and soft skills are key to overcoming early hurdles and building a successful freelance career.

What is a Freelance Junior Java Developer?

A Freelance Junior Java Developer is an entry-level programmer who works independently on a contract basis, specializing in Java development. They typically handle coding, debugging, and basic software tasks for clients rather than being employed full-time by a single company. Freelance junior developers often work on smaller projects or assist senior developers, allowing them to gain experience and build their portfolios. This role requires a solid understanding of Java fundamentals and the ability to adapt to different project requirements.

What is the difference between Freelance Junior Java Developer vs Junior Java Developer?

AspectFreelance Junior Java DeveloperJunior Java Developer
Work EnvironmentIndependent, remote or contract-based projectsFull-time employment in a company or organization
CredentialsTypically requires basic Java knowledge, some coding experienceOften requires a degree or certification in computer science or related field
Employer & Industry UsageClients across various industries, project-basedEmployers in tech, finance, or enterprise sectors
Work ScopeLimited to specific projects, flexible hoursPart of a team, involved in ongoing development tasks

In summary, a Freelance Junior Java Developer works independently on short-term projects, often remotely, with flexible hours and minimal formal employment ties. In contrast, a Junior Java Developer is typically employed full-time within a company, working as part of a team on continuous development tasks, often requiring formal education or certifications.
